Healthcare Key Theme

We help society combat disease and improve wellbeing through our research and teaching in health economics, policy and management. We focus on the incentives that drive productivity, quality and innovation both at the health system and organisational level; on the incentives that drive health-related behaviours at the individual level; and on the factors that determine the success of health policies designed and implemented by governments.

Working closely with colleagues across Imperial College London, our research informs international policy and practice by taking a distinctive user-engagement approach: we operate across disciplinary boundaries working with high level policy-makers, managers, administrators, clinicians and the industrial supply chain to develop strategic policy, implement new approaches and improve existing operational models.
